A delivery rider has been taken to hospital following a collision with a bus in Station Road, Harrow Town Centre this evening.
Emergency services rushed to the scene, and police have taped off the area, leading to a temporary road closure. The extent of the rider’s injuries is currently unknown.

A Metropolitan Police spokesperson confirmed that officers remain at the scene, and investigations into the circumstances of the crash are ongoing.
Drivers and pedestrians are advised to avoid the area while emergency teams carry out their work.
Anyone with witness information or dashcam footage is urged to contact Met Police on 101
